What is the difference between Microsoft Practice Lead vs Microsoft Solutions Architect?

AspectMicrosoft Practice LeadMicrosoft Solutions Architect
Primary FocusLeading Microsoft technology practices, managing teams, and driving strategic initiativesDesigning and implementing specific Microsoft solutions for clients
Required SkillsLeadership, project management, deep Microsoft product knowledgeTechnical expertise in Microsoft solutions, architecture design, problem-solving
Work EnvironmentConsulting firms, large enterprises, Microsoft partnersClient sites, consulting firms, project-based roles
CertificationsMicrosoft certifications (e.g., MCSE, MCSD), leadership credentialsMicrosoft certifications (e.g., Azure Solutions Architect, Microsoft 365)

The Microsoft Practice Lead focuses on leading teams and strategic direction within Microsoft technologies, while the Microsoft Solutions Architect concentrates on designing and implementing specific solutions for clients. Both roles require strong Microsoft certifications and industry experience, but their core responsibilities differ in scope and focus.

Job description

Burns & McDonnell is seeking an Associate/Principal Engineer, Hydrogeologist, Scientist in a related field to join our successful team of remediation professionals in our Environmental Services Group. The successful candidate will be responsible for leading projects and pursuits in the Sediments market and lead of dedicated team of professionals towards profitable growth within the remediation market and executing existing projects. 

This individual will serve as the sediment practice lead for the Remediation group to provide leadership around sediment remediation projects and design expertise to guide a variety of projects through site investigation, remedy evaluation and selection, design, construction, and restoration. This role will also lead national business development campaigns to grow Burns & McDonnell’s sediment portfolio and lead critical pursuit efforts.

  • Prepare and implement strategic plans to capture existing project leads, convert design projects to construction opportunities, and expand sales in the Sediment Remediation market.
  • Lead teams to develop and implement pre-design investigations, feasibility studies, treatability studies, conceptual site model development, remedial design and remedial action implementation.
  • Manage/direct staff in data collection, synthesis, analysis and interpretation using industry standard procedures.
  • Manage large/complex sediment investigation and remediation projects. When operating in this role, be responsible for the financial success of the project including preparation of cost proposals and qualification statements and achieving stated targets and standards for financial performance.
  • Provide leadership, instruction, and advanced technical guidance to less experienced project staff.  Support client communications surrounding sediment remediation on key accounts.
  • Present technical papers at professional meetings.
  • Develop and maintain effective relationships with existing clients, customers and contractors in order to develop new business opportunities.
  • Facilitate QA/QC process adherence on projects and proposals completed under their control.
  • Ensure compliance with company and site safety policies.
  • Performs other duties as assigned
  • Bachelor Degree in Engineering, Hydrogeology, or a related field from an accredited program and 7 years related consulting experience (15 years preferred).
  • Master Degree in a related field from an accredited program may substitute for one year of experience.
  • Proven track record of practice/business unit leadership with demonstrated sales and portfolio growth within the remediation market.
  • Expert knowledge of sediment fate and transport.
  • Expert knowledge of and experience with active sediment remediation including dredging, capping, and other industry standard methods.
  • Strong working knowledge of regulatory frameworks, including CERCLA, RCRA, Section 401 and Section 404 permitting.
  • Ability to establish effective working relationships with contractors, co-workers, and other professionals.
  • Expert analytical and problem-solving skills.
  • Expert oral and written communication skills; ability to clearly and effectively present complex information to all levels of employees, management, and clients.
  • Expert in the use of computer software (i.e., Microsoft Word, Excel, PowerPoint).
